Precision Agitation: Why Detailing Brushes are Essential

In the Australian automotive landscape, the environment is a constant adversary. From the fine, iron-rich red dust of the Pilbara that find its way into every window seal, to the corrosive salt spray of the Gold Coast and the acidic bat droppings common in suburban Brisbane, standard washing techniques often fall short. A wash mitt or microfibre cloth is a blunt instrument; detailing brushes are the scalpels of the car care world. They allow for the safe agitation of cleaning agents in intricate areas where contaminants congregate—lug nuts, honeycomb grilles, badging, and interior switchgear. Neglecting these areas leads to long-term degradation: red dust can act as an abrasive, grinding down plastic clips and seals, while salt trapped in trim gaps accelerates oxidation and 'white worm' corrosion on alloy surfaces. By integrating professional-grade brushes into your workflow, you ensure that 'invisible' contaminants are removed before they can cause permanent damage. This guide focuses on the technical application of various bristle types—boar’s hair, synthetic, and ultra-soft—to provide a level of cleanliness that protects your vehicle's resale value and aesthetic integrity against the relentless 40°C+ summer heat and high UV index.

The Professional Brush & Chemical Arsenal

Equipment Checklist

0/8
Natural Boar's Hair Brushes (Set of 3 sizes) — Essential for exterior agitation. Look for 25mm, 30mm, and 40mm diameters. These are durable and chemical resistant for engine bays and wheel faces.
Synthetic Soft-Tip Brushes — Specifically designed for scratch-prone surfaces like piano black interior trim or navigation screens. Ensure they have flagged tips.
Chemical Resistant Stiff Brushes — Heavy-duty nylon or stiff synthetic for tyre sidewalls and wheel arches to remove baked-on mud and road grime.
pH Neutral All-Purpose Cleaner (APC) — Concentrated formula (e.g., P&S Express or local brands like Bowden's Own). Mix at 10:1 for interiors and 4:1 for heavy exterior degreasing.
Dedicated Wheel Cleaner — A non-acidic, pH-neutral iron dissolver (reactive) for safe use on Australian-spec alloy wheels.
Distilled Water in a Spray Bottle — Used for 'damp-brushing' delicate interior components to prevent chemical spotting in high heat.
Microfibre Work Towels (300 GSM) — At least 10 towels for wiping away agitated foam before it dries; separate towels for 'dirty' (wheels) and 'clean' (interior) zones.
Brush Storage Rack or Pouch — Crucial for hanging brushes bristles-down to prevent water from rotting the wooden handles or loosening the epoxy glue in the ferrule.

Preparation and Environmental Assessment

Tap each step to mark complete
01

Surface Temperature Verification

In Australian summer conditions, panels can reach 70°C. Use an infrared thermometer or the back of your hand to ensure surfaces are cool to the touch. Never use detailing brushes with chemicals on hot surfaces, as the rapid evaporation will cause the chemical to etch the surface or leave permanent 'tiger stripes' in the plastic trim.

02

Pre-Rinse and Debris Removal

Use a pressure washer or high-flow hose to remove loose grit, red dust, and sand. Using a brush on a dry, dusty surface is essentially sandpapering your paint. Focus on flushing out the gaps around window seals and badges where Australian dust tends to settle and harden into 'mud' when it meets morning dew.

03

Chemical Dilution and Labelling

Prepare your APC or dedicated cleaners in spray bottles. For Australian conditions, err on the side of caution with higher dilutions (weaker) because the heat accelerates chemical reactions. A 15:1 ratio for APC is often sufficient for interior dusting and light grime, reducing the risk of staining leather or vinyl.

04

Brush Inspection

Examine every brush for 'hooked' bristles or trapped grit from previous sessions. Run your fingers through the bristles; if they feel stiff or crunchy, they contain dried product that can scratch paint. Rinse them in warm water and spin dry before starting the current job.

The Technical Brushing Process

Tap each step to mark complete
01

The 'Dry Brush' Dusting (Interior Only)

Before applying any liquids to the interior, use a clean, dry, ultra-soft synthetic brush to agitate dust out of air vents and button crevices while holding a vacuum nozzle nearby. This prevents the dust from turning into a slurry that gets trapped deeper in the electronics.

02

Exterior Badge and Emblem Agitation

Spray a pH-neutral APC directly onto a damp boar's hair brush, not the car. Work the brush in small, circular motions around badges (e.g., '4x4' or brand logos). The bristles should get behind the lettering to lift the green algae or red dust common in coastal and rural areas. Work for 30-45 seconds per badge.

03

Window Seal and Trim Deep Clean

Apply cleaner to a medium-sized brush and run the bristles along the felt or rubber window tracks. In Australia, these seals often dry out and trap sand, which eventually scratches the glass. Use straight-line strokes to pull the dirt out rather than pushing it further in.

04

Fuel Door and Cap Maintenance

The fuel filler area is a magnet for dust and spilled diesel/petrol. Use a boar's hair brush with a degreaser to clean the hinges and the inner rim. This prevents grime from falling into the fuel tank during refilling in dusty outback conditions.

05

Wheel Nut Recess Cleaning

Using a dedicated wheel brush, agitate your wheel cleaner inside the lug nut holes. This is a high-heat area where brake dust bakes onto the surface. Circular agitation is key here to ensure 360-degree coverage of the nut and the surrounding alloy.

06

Grille and Honeycomb Intricacies

Modern Australian SUVs have complex grilles. Use a long-reach detailing brush to clean each individual cell. This is vital for airflow to the radiator, especially when towing in 40°C heat. Work from top to bottom to ensure the dirty runoff doesn't contaminate cleaned areas.

07

Interior Switchgear and Centre Console

Switch to an ultra-soft synthetic brush. Lightly mist the brush with an interior detailer. Agitate around gear shifters and window switches. The goal is 'foaming' the product slightly to lift skin oils and sunscreen—which is particularly aggressive on Australian car interiors—without letting liquid seep into the electronics.

08

Door Jamb and Hinge Degreasing

Door jambs collect road salt and red mud. Use a larger boar's hair brush and a stronger APC dilution (4:1). Agitate the hinges and the 'shut' lines. This prevents the grease from becoming contaminated with grit, which can lead to door creaking and premature hinge wear.

09

Tyre Sidewall Scrubbing

Apply a stiff nylon brush to the tyre sidewalls. In Australia, tyres often 'bloom' or turn brown due to UV exposure and antiozonants. Scrub vigorously in a circular motion until the foam turns from brown to white. This provides a clean 'anchor' for tyre dressings to bond to.

10

Engine Bay Detailing (Plastics and Hoses)

On a cool engine, use a large boar's hair brush to agitate degreaser on the engine cover and visible hoses. This is the best way to remove the fine 'bull dust' that coats engines after outback trips, which can otherwise act as an insulator and trap heat.

11

Rinsing and Residue Management

Immediately after brushing any exterior section, rinse with a low-pressure stream. Do not allow the agitated suds to dry. In 35°C+ weather, you should work panel by panel or even section by section to ensure no chemical residue is left behind.

12

Microfibre Blotting

After rinsing, use a clean microfibre to blot (not rub) the areas you just brushed. This removes any remaining suspended particles that the brush loosened but the water didn't fully carry away.

Avoid Direct Sunlight and High Heat

Never perform detailing brush agitation in direct Australian sun. The metal and plastic surfaces can exceed 60°C, causing cleaning chemicals to flash-dry instantly. This leads to chemical etching on delicate plastics and 'permanent' water spots on paint that require machine polishing to remove. Always work in a garage, under a carport, or during the 'golden hours' of early morning or late evening.

Cross-Contamination Hazards

Do not use the same brush for wheels and interior surfaces. Wheel brushes collect microscopic metallic brake dust particles and heavy road grit. Even if rinsed, these particles can remain trapped in the ferrule and, if used on an interior dashboard or leather seat, will cause irreversible scratching. Maintain a strict colour-coded system or clearly label your brushes: 'Wheels', 'Body', and 'Interior'.

Ferrule Impact Damage

Be extremely cautious of the 'ferrule' (the part connecting the handle to the bristles). Many cheap brushes have metal ferrules that can gouge paint or plastic if you accidentally bump the surface while agitating. Always opt for brushes with plastic or rubber-wrapped ferrules, and never apply excessive downward pressure; let the tips of the bristles do the work.

The 'Two-Bucket' Brush Rinse

Just like the two-bucket wash method, keep a small jar or bucket of clean water specifically for rinsing your brushes as you work. After agitating a dirty badge or wheel nut, swirl the brush in the rinse water and flick it dry. This ensures you aren't just moving red dust from one crevice to another, but actually removing it from the vehicle.

Sunscreen Removal Technique

Australian drivers often deal with white sunscreen stains on door cards and armrests. Use a soft synthetic brush with a dedicated leather/vinyl cleaner. Agitate in a tight circular motion to create a 'lather'. The bristles reach into the grain of the vinyl where cloths cannot, lifting the zinc oxide from the sunscreen effectively.

Storage for Longevity

After your detail, wash your brushes with a mild dish soap to remove oils and chemicals. Hang them upside down (bristles facing the floor). If stored bristles-up, water seeps into the handle, causing wooden handles to swell and crack, and eventually causing the glue to fail, leading to 'shedding' during your next detail.

05

Long-Term Maintenance of Brushes and Surfaces

Maintaining your detailing brushes is as important as the car itself. In the high-humidity coastal regions of Australia, brushes left damp in a closed bag can develop mould. Always ensure they are bone-dry before storage. Regarding the vehicle, the areas cleaned with brushes (badges, seals, and trim) should be treated with a UV-protectant (like Aerospace 303 or a local ceramic trim restorer) every 4-8 weeks. Because these areas were deep-cleaned, they are now more receptive to protectants, which will prevent the 'chalking' and fading common in the Australian sun. If you notice red dust beginning to 'stain' the edges of your badges again, it is time for a maintenance brush-clean. For daily drivers in dusty environments, a 'dry-brush' dusting of the interior should be performed fortnightly to prevent dust buildup from becoming abrasive.

Troubleshooting and Frequently Asked Questions

The bristles are shedding on my car; what do I do?
Shedding is common with new natural boar's hair brushes. However, if an old brush starts shedding, the glue in the ferrule has likely failed due to harsh chemicals or improper storage. Stop using it immediately, as the loose bristles can get trapped in window seals or mechanical parts. Replace with a high-quality epoxy-set brush.
I've agitated the red dust, but the plastic still looks 'stained'.
Outback red dust contains iron oxide which can physically dye porous plastics. If a pH-neutral APC and brush agitation don't work, you may need a dedicated 'Iron Remover' spray. Apply to the brush, agitate the area, let sit for 2 minutes (do not let dry), and rinse. This chemically dissolves the iron particles.
Can I use a paintbrush from a hardware store instead?
It is not recommended. Household paintbrushes often have metal ferrules that rust or scratch paint, and the bristles are usually not 'flagged' (split at the ends), making them too stiff and aggressive for automotive clear coats. Professional detailing brushes are designed to be chemical resistant and soft enough for paint.
The APC dried on the plastic and left a white mark. How do I fix it?
This is common in hot weather. Re-wet the area with the same APC to 'reactivate' the dried product, agitate gently with your brush, and rinse immediately with plenty of water. If the mark remains, you may need to apply a trim dressing to hydrate the plastic.
How do I clean 'Piano Black' trim without scratching it?
Piano black is the most delicate surface. Use ONLY an ultra-soft 'makeup style' synthetic brush. Use zero pressure; let the weight of the brush do the work. Always use a dedicated interior detailer with high lubricity to provide a buffer between the bristles and the plastic.
My brush smells like rotten eggs after cleaning wheels.
This is a reaction between the boar's hair and iron-dissolving wheel cleaners (which contain thioglycolic acid). Thoroughly wash the brush with a degreaser or dish soap and air-dry in a well-ventilated area. To avoid this, use synthetic brushes with reactive wheel cleaners.
